Caracas (CCS) to Kaieteur Falls (KIA)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Maiquetia (Simon Bolivar Internacional) Airport (CCS) in Caracas, Venezuela to Kaieteur International Airport (KIA) in Kaieteur Falls, Guyana is 1,023 kilometers (636 miles / 552 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ying southeast at a heading of 126°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ting Venezuela with Guyana.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 05:27 in Caracas, it's 05:27 in Kaieteur Falls.

The return flight from Kaieteur Falls (KIA) to Caracas (CCS) follows a heading of 307° (northw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
